A really nice, high quality apron in wool with a matching linen dress. Known as a Smokkr, this type of dress was a common garment among the Viking women who combined it with a pair of turtle brooches with stringed beads. The brooches are used to fasten the shoulder straps in the front. They can also be stitched in place quite easily.
